Here is a picture of a steering knuckle/spindle I pulled off my 09' Escape. You'll notice the machined mating surfaces and it may be hard to tell, but it was never painted from the factory. I also posted up a pic of a knuckle with the OEM raw cast appearance.
There maybe some quality issues somewhere, but the paint on the spindle isn't one of them. It only stands out because the spindle was painted prior to the machining operation. Most factory spindles I've seen aren't even painted.
